#ef3a38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ef3a38 is composed of 93.7% red, 22.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.7%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 0.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#ef3a38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7470 with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#ef3a38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ef3a38 has RGB values of R:239, G:58,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.77,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15678008.

Shades and Tints of #ef3a38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feeeee is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ef3a38
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949393 is the less saturated color, while #f73230 is the most saturated one.
